As there are types of fibroid surgeries, I would assume that she underwent myomectomy which is the main option among the surgeries for women with fibroids, and still wants to bear children in the future. Surgery is an option when getting rid of fibroids but it does come with risks such as bleeding, fertility issues etc. And despite the obvious advantages of certain fibroid surgeries, its role in treatment of infertility has been issue of continuous debate. But before moving further, fertility issues are sometimes from both partners. Have you also be checked and you're clean? |
